A high-yield account is a type of deposit account that offers higher interest rates than traditional savings accounts.

High-yield accounts are designed to help customers grow their savings more effectively by providing competitive interest rates that outpace inflation.

Online banks and financial institutions typically provide these accounts, passing on the savings from lower operating costs to their customers in the form of better returns on their savings.

These accounts often come with additional features, such as no minimum balance requirements and higher FDIC insurance limits.

Higher interest rates allow customers to grow their savings more effectively over time, outpacing inflation and providing a better return than most traditional savings accounts.

Opening a Betterment Cash Reserve account is a straightforward online process that can be completed in just a few minutes. You'll need to visit the Betterment website and create a new account by providing your personal information, including your name, address, Social Security number, and date of birth.

To link your external bank account, you'll need to provide your bank account information, including the routing and account numbers. Betterment will send two small deposits to your linked bank account, which you'll need to verify to complete the process.

The verification process typically takes a few days, but it's an important step in ensuring the security of your account. Once your account is set up and verified, you can transfer funds to your Betterment Cash Reserve account and earn interest on your deposits.

Here's a step-by-step guide to opening a Betterment Cash Reserve account:

  1. Visit the Betterment website and create a new account.
  2. Link your external bank account by providing your bank account information.
  3. Verify your linked bank account by confirming the two small deposits sent by Betterment.
  4. Transfer funds to your Betterment Cash Reserve account and earn interest on your deposits.
